About this office

The State Executive Committee is the elected governing body of a Tennessee political party (Democratic or Republican). It is a party-organization office, not a government office — its members set party rules and organization, and are chosen by voters in that party's primary.

Term length: 4 years.

This role calls for

  • Intra-party governance: the State Executive Committee is the elected governing body of a Tennessee political party, not a public office that legislates or administers government.
  • Working knowledge of party rules, conventions, ballot-access requirements, and how the party interacts with state election law.
  • Coordination with the party chair and county-level party committees.
  • This is a partisan party-organization role; voters in the party's primary choose the committee members. The qualities here describe party-organization fit, not government competency.
